Sean Kingston Verdict: Singer and Mother Janice Turner Found Guilty in Fraud Case

Sean Kingston, known for his hit "Beautiful Girls," and his mother, Janice Turner, were found guilty in a fraud case. They were accused of scamming vendors out of goods worth $1 million.
The verdict came from a federal court in Florida. The trial concluded on March 28, with both Kingston and Turner facing serious charges. They each were convicted of one conspiracy count and four wire fraud counts, according to NBC News.
Sentencing is scheduled for July 11. Kingston, at 35, is currently under house arrest, while 61-year-old Turner has been placed in federal custody.
Details of the Fraud Scheme
The mother-son duo was accused of stealing luxury items, including cars and jewelry. They allegedly tricked vendors by falsely claiming to have initiated bank wire transfers. This claim was made clear in a press release from the U.S. Attorney's Office in the Southern District of Florida.

Kingston was arrested on May 23, 2024, shortly after Turner’s police custody during a raid at his Florida rental home. He waived his right to contest extradition and was moved to Florida. After posting bail, Kingston and Turner entered not guilty pleas.
Testimony and Defense
During the trial, which started on March 24, Turner testified about handling her son's finances irresponsibly. She claimed to have created fraudulent wire transfers. Turner explained that Kingston needed to sustain a celebrity lifestyle and that she had been misled by businesses previously. She defended her actions, arguing that the fake documents were intended to buy time for investigating the vendors' legitimacy.
Kingston opted not to testify. His defense attorney described him as "still a kid in his mind," suggesting he struggles to understand business processes. However, the prosecution countered this argument. "There's only one reason to create fake documents," remarked assistant U.S. attorney Marc Anton. "To trick someone."
